Evaluation of art subjects implemented in the marquetry technique by the optical coherence microscopy method
Authors:Igor Gurov  Nikita Margaryants  Ekaterina Zhukova
Abstract:Evaluation of internal microstructure of decorative and applied art objects implemented in the intarsia and marquetry techniques by the optical coherence tomography method is considered. The high resolving optical coherence microscope with a radiation source with tunable wavelength in the range of 1305 ± 75 nm was applied. The ability to analyse layered microstructure of wood object surface layer in intarsia regions is demonstrated. The geometric features evaluation of the object's microstructure in the areas of interest was conducted. Systematisation of layers structure and typical defects inherent in intarsia regions was performed considering the structural features that may be important for restoration of such objects. Examples of experimentally obtained B‐scans and three‐dimensional representations of sample fragments of microstructure studied by the optical coherence microscopy method are given.
